High Wind Warning
Statement as of 8:08 am PST on November 9, 2009


... High Wind Warning now in effect until noon PST today for The
Headlands and beaches along the South Washington and north Oregon
coasts...

The High Wind Warning has been extended until noon PST today.

A brief period of very strong south winds 30 to 40 mph with gusts
to near 60 mph are expected this morning at the beaches and
coastal headlands of the South Washington and north Oregon
coasts. These winds will be produced ahead of a strong Pacific
cold front.

The winds are expected to decrease by noon once the cold front
moves onshore.

Precautionary/preparedness actions...

A High Wind Warning means a hazardous high wind event is expected
or occurring. Sustained wind speeds of at least 40 mph or gusts
of 58 mph or more can lead to property damage.
